Real Linux?
Real Linux?
Поработав полгода с PocketPC 2002 на тоше e570, понял что "Всеми Любимая Корпорация" даже для кпк не может ничего нормального сделать, поэтому хочу узнать насколько Linux на Sharp'ах реальный. В первую очередь интересует наличие простых консольных утилиток наподобие find , grep , cat , tar и т.д. Наличие простого, но функционального редактора вроде vi и Shell'a.
P.S. А кстати, он open source?
P.S. А кстати, он open source?
ViV уже ответил, так, что даже добавить-то особенно нечего...
Разве что по поводу консольных утилит - все Вами перечисленные сразу включены в прошивку. Правда некоторые из них, в целях экономии места во внутреннем флеше, реализованы через busybox.
Я предпочитаю заменять их на gnu версии.
vi и bash есть. Из оболочек кроме bash'а есть ash, уоторый может использоваться в целях экономии ОЗУ. Прочие оболочки (csh, ksh, zsh...) пользователь должен устанавливать сам.
Есть emacs и другие популярные консольные редакторы.
Проблема, правда, с самой консолью - если используется прошивка с Qtopia (второй вариант - XFree), то для получения чисто текстовой консоли потребуется переключать runlevel - сменить в Qtopia консоль невозможно (можно, конечно, пользоваться эмулятором терминала не выходя из Qtopia - по аналогии с xterm или, даже ближе, konsole).
Насколько открыты тексты?
Так же как в настольном варианте - ядро открыто практически полностью (при сборке используется закрытый объектный файл с драйвером sd-разъема, но и в настольном варианте таких драйверов хватает - все, кто пользуется видеокартами от Nvidia/ATI с этим сталкивались), остальные программы - какие открыты, какие нет.
Естественно, что большинство специфических для zaurus'а приложений (PIM, Hancom office и т.д.) закрыты.
Не очень специфические, но платные (Opera, Netfront) закрыты тоже.
Практически любую программу, для которой есть открытый исходный текст, можно собрать для zaurus'а.
Или не мучаться со сборкой, а просто (как уже написал ViV) взять из arm-debian.
Разве что по поводу консольных утилит - все Вами перечисленные сразу включены в прошивку. Правда некоторые из них, в целях экономии места во внутреннем флеше, реализованы через busybox.
Я предпочитаю заменять их на gnu версии.
vi и bash есть. Из оболочек кроме bash'а есть ash, уоторый может использоваться в целях экономии ОЗУ. Прочие оболочки (csh, ksh, zsh...) пользователь должен устанавливать сам.
Есть emacs и другие популярные консольные редакторы.
Проблема, правда, с самой консолью - если используется прошивка с Qtopia (второй вариант - XFree), то для получения чисто текстовой консоли потребуется переключать runlevel - сменить в Qtopia консоль невозможно (можно, конечно, пользоваться эмулятором терминала не выходя из Qtopia - по аналогии с xterm или, даже ближе, konsole).
Насколько открыты тексты?
Так же как в настольном варианте - ядро открыто практически полностью (при сборке используется закрытый объектный файл с драйвером sd-разъема, но и в настольном варианте таких драйверов хватает - все, кто пользуется видеокартами от Nvidia/ATI с этим сталкивались), остальные программы - какие открыты, какие нет.
Естественно, что большинство специфических для zaurus'а приложений (PIM, Hancom office и т.д.) закрыты.
Не очень специфические, но платные (Opera, Netfront) закрыты тоже.
Практически любую программу, для которой есть открытый исходный текст, можно собрать для zaurus'а.
Или не мучаться со сборкой, а просто (как уже написал ViV) взять из arm-debian.
Последний раз редактировалось ВадимП Чт сен 02, 2004 11:55, всего редактировалось 1 раз.
Спасибо за ответы! Честно говоря, о таком даже и не мечтал. Теперь встал вопрос выбора модели.
Большенство шарпов клавиатурные, следовательно громоздкие и дорогие. В данный момент необходимости в реальной клавиатуре я не испытываю, поэтому мне понравилась моделька Sharp Zaurus SL-A300, и в связи с этим еще вопросы:
1) применимо ли к ней все вышесказанное?
2) не будет ли проблем с виртуальной клавиатурой?
3) достаточно ли 200мгц для комфортной работы?
4) есть ли основания для того чтобы взять более серьезную модель?
Большенство шарпов клавиатурные, следовательно громоздкие и дорогие. В данный момент необходимости в реальной клавиатуре я не испытываю, поэтому мне понравилась моделька Sharp Zaurus SL-A300, и в связи с этим еще вопросы:
1) применимо ли к ней все вышесказанное?
2) не будет ли проблем с виртуальной клавиатурой?
3) достаточно ли 200мгц для комфортной работы?
4) есть ли основания для того чтобы взять более серьезную модель?
Два огромных минуса A300 - это отсутствие клавиатуры и доисторическое разрешение.
Причем это важно не только для графики, а не в последнюю очередь и для консоли - все уважающие себя программы предполагают, что окно терминала имеет по крайней мере 80 символов в ширину.
Быстродействие процессора для них, само собой, никакого значения не имеет.
Причем это важно не только для графики, а не в последнюю очередь и для консоли - все уважающие себя программы предполагают, что окно терминала имеет по крайней мере 80 символов в ширину.
Быстродействие процессора для них, само собой, никакого значения не имеет.
Ниже Антон описал доводы в пользу С700 по сравнению с A300.BetaChild писал(а):Спасибо за ответы! Честно говоря, о таком даже и не мечтал. Теперь встал вопрос выбора модели.
Большенство шарпов клавиатурные, следовательно громоздкие и дорогие. В данный момент необходимости в реальной клавиатуре я не испытываю, поэтому мне понравилась моделька Sharp Zaurus SL-A300, и в связи с этим еще вопросы:
1) применимо ли к ней все вышесказанное?
2) не будет ли проблем с виртуальной клавиатурой?
3) достаточно ли 200мгц для комфортной работы?
4) есть ли основания для того чтобы взять более серьезную модель?
Я как раз надумал сменить свой С700 на С760.
Если заинтересован, то пиши в ЛС.